Franco Beraldo was born in 1944 in Meolo, a small village in the Venetian countryside. He moved to Mestre a few years later, where he still lives and works today. His artistic career began in 1965, and since then he has received numerous awards and recognitions.
Beraldo is part of the family here: uncle of Matteo, the restaurant’s owner, he is a regular and loyal fan of one dish in particular , the “alici in teglia”, known for its pleasant and unmistakable flavor.
